-/* Allocate N bytes of memory dynamically, with error checking. */
-void *
-xmalloc (n)
- size_t n;
-{
- void *p;
-
- p = malloc (n);
- if (p == NULL)
- error (EXIT_FAILURE, 0, _("memory exhausted"));
- return p;
-}
-
-
-/* Allocate memory for N elements of S bytes, with error checking. */
-void *
-xcalloc (n, s)
- size_t n, s;
-{
- void *p;
-
- p = calloc (n, s);
- if (p == NULL)
- error (EXIT_FAILURE, 0, _("memory exhausted"));
- return p;
-}
-
-
-/* Change the size of an allocated block of memory P to N bytes,
- with error checking. */
-void *
-xrealloc (p, n)
- void *p;
- size_t n;
-{
- p = realloc (p, n);
- if (p == NULL)
- error (EXIT_FAILURE, 0, _("memory exhausted"));
- return p;
-}
